Our friends in the discipline comparative linguistics tell us that various components of indigenous languages (structure, intonations, etc.) usually change after every 500 years! Now the various communities on New Guinea and the Solomon Islands have lived for 40,000 - 10,000 years in complete isolation from each other. So you can appreciate why we are so linguistically diverse in Western Melanesia!
